Very pale golden. Very light salty with nashi (Japanese pear) and a touch of cereal. Very light body, highly refreshing, slightly salty. Almost like biting into a nashi with salt on it. Good stuff

Batch #3 from tap at the brewery. Hazy, bright gold with a tall fine head, quite reminiscent of champagne. Crisp, fruity nose, more grapefruit and citrus than nashi, but that comes through a bit too, some creamy lactic stuff as well. Dry, fruity flavor. Lightly sweet, lightly sour, not too acid. Elegant and light, crisp and dry. Great stuff.
